Special Notes:

CARBON DIOXIDE (TC02) See penalties set out in Equine Classification Policy and Penalty Guidelines.

COCAINE If it is determined by the Stewards that the administration of cocaine was unintentional and not based upon an attempt to affect the outcome of a race, the Stewards may elect to assign a Class B penalty to the trainer.

DIMETHYSULFOXIDE (DMSO) See penalties set out in Equine Medication Classification Policy and Penalty Guidelines.

FUROSIMIDE See penalties set out in Equine Medication Classification Policy and Penalty Guidelines.

METHAMPHETAMINE Recommended Penalty B if testing can prove presence of only levo-methamphetamine is present in sample.

MORPHINE If it is determined by the Stewards that the administration of morphine was unintentional and not based upon an attempt to affect the outcome of a race, the Stewards may elect to assign a Class B penalty to the trainer.

PHENYLBUTAZONE See penalties set out in Equine Medication Classification Policy and Penalty Guidelines.
